1755 JOHN M'LAURIN. Life and Sermons of George Whitefield's Scottish Co-Revivalist. First Edition! ExpositionNicely preserved volume of sermons by John MLaurin [McLaurin], minister at Glasgow and one of the chief supports of George Whitefield during the Glasgow and Cambuslang Revivals. He was, in fact, co preacher with him and led the receiving of the sacrament in the famed field services of the Lords Supper. The volume itself is also edited by John Gillies, author of perhaps the most important historical book on revivals ever written, Historical Collections
